- The distance between Varena, Lithuania and Belém, Brazil is approximately 9,048 km or 5,622 mi.
- To reach Varena in this distance one would set out from Belém bearing 34.4°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Varena bearing 75.2° or ENE .
- Varena has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Belém has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- Varena is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Belém is in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 19.7 °C (35.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20.5 °C (36.9°F) more in Varena.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2235.1 mm (88 in) less which is equivalent to 2235.1 l/m² (54.85 US gal/ft²) or 22,351,000 l/ha (2,389,470 US gal/ac) less. About 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 38.8° lower in Varena than in Belém.
